About G3D Mark
G3D Mark is a standard benchmark that measures graphics performance in real-world gaming scenarios. It simplifies comparing cards from different brands, where higher scores directly correlate with better fps and smoother gaming experiences.

FirePro M4150
The FirePro M4150 is manufactured by AMD. It was released in October 16 2013. It features the GCN 1.0 architecture. The core clock speed is 715 MHz. It has 384 shading units. The thermal design power (TDP) is 150W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 1,011 points.

FirePro V4900
The FirePro V4900 is manufactured by AMD. It was released in November 1 2011. It features the TeraScale 2 architecture. The core clock speed is 800 MHz. It has 480 shading units. The thermal design power (TDP) is 75W. Manufactured using 40 nm process technology. G3D Mark benchmark score: 1,009 points.
Graphics Performance
The FirePro M4150 scores 1,011 and the FirePro V4900 reaches 1,009 in the G3D Mark benchmark — just a 0.2% difference, making them near-identical in rasterization performance. The FirePro M4150 is built on GCN 1.0 while the FirePro V4900 uses TeraScale 2, both on 28 nm vs 40 nm. Shader units: 384 (FirePro M4150) vs 480 (FirePro V4900). Raw compute: 0.5491 TFLOPS (FirePro M4150) vs 0.768 TFLOPS (FirePro V4900).

Video Memory (VRAM)
The FirePro M4150 has 4 GB of VRAM, while the FirePro V4900 carries 1 GB. FirePro M4150 gives you 300% more memory capacity, which matters more once you move into heavier textures, mods, or higher resolutions. Memory bus width is 64-bit on the FirePro M4150 and 64-bit on the FirePro V4900.

Display & API Support
DirectX support: 12 (FirePro M4150) vs 11 (FirePro V4900). Vulkan: 1.2 vs None. OpenGL: 4.6 vs 4.4. Maximum simultaneous displays: 6 vs 3.

Power & Dimensions
The FirePro M4150 draws 150W versus the FirePro V4900's 75W — a 66.7% difference. The FirePro V4900 is more power-efficient. Recommended PSU: 350W (FirePro M4150) vs 350W (FirePro V4900). Power connectors: PCIe-powered vs PCIe-powered. Card length: 0mm vs 163mm, occupying 1 vs 1 slots. Typical load temperature: 70°C vs 75°C.
